Web Ads: Finding the Right Format for Your Campaign
When crafting a successful online advertising campaign, selecting the optimal banner ad format is crucial. Banner ads come in a variety of shapes and sizes, each with its unique strengths. Understanding these different formats empowers you to choose the best solution for your specific marketing targets.
- Graphical Banners: These are the classic rectangular banners that adorn websites. They can be static or animated, and offer a wide range of creative choices.
- Header: These long, narrow banners sit at the top of web pages, capturing viewer attention as they navigate.
- Medium Rectangle: These ads strike a balance between visibility and space usage. They work well for showcasing product visuals.
To maximize your results, consider your target market and the specific message you want to convey. Experiment with different banner ad formats and analyze their effectiveness to refine your advertising strategy over time.
